Abstract
The invention discloses a formula and a using method of novel bactericide for preventing and treating rice blast. The formula of the bactericide belongs to the formula of a compatible bactericide of ternary active ingredients, namely tricyclazole, tebuconazole and difenoconazole with high efficiency and low toxicity. The novel bactericide is processed into preparation and the preparation is mixed with water for atomizing, soaking seed or broadcasting, thus preventing and treating rice blast. The novel bactericide has the advantages of being long in effective duration period, integrating protection function, treating function with anti-sporing function, promoting the healthy growth of rice, obviously improving the seed setting percentage and the thousand-grain weight of the rice, treating the drug resistance of pathogenic bacteria and the like.

Two, technical background
Characteristics such as azoles fungicide has wide, the active height of fungicidal spectrum, sterilization speed is fast, the lasting period is long, interior suction conductivity is strong, principal item has Tebuconazole, Difenoconazole, triazolone, Triadimenol, own azoles alcohol, propiconazole, nitrile bacterium azoles, Flutriafol, Prochloraz etc.The mechanism of action of azoles fungicide is to suppress the biosynthesis of ergosterol, destroys the cell membrane function of pathogen, finally causes cell death, thereby plays protection and therapeutic action.Azoles fungicide can effectively be prevented and treated the caused fungal diseases of plants of sac fungi, basidiomycetes and imperfect fungus.Tens of kinds of crop pests such as paddy rice, cereal crop, vegetables, fruit tree been have successfully have been prevented and treated both at home and abroad with this series bactericidal agent.The Application and Development of this class new type bactericide is for the invention provides material base.
Rice blast is the important disease that hazard rice is produced for a long time, and its pathogen can be infected the host in arbitrary stage of paddy growth, causes economic loss.At present China uses mainly that toxicity is medium, bactericide such as the tricyclazole that has only prevention effect and sulphur prevent and treat, wherein tricyclazole is to synthesize by the melanin that the inhibition Pyricularia oryzae adheres in the spore, hinder rice blast fungus and invade in the pin main body, reach the purpose of specialization control rice blast.Yet Pyricularia oryzae is invaded under the invisible situation of naked eyes to visible disease symptom and is occurred, and also needs 5-7 days time under optimum, and the germ tube of germ spore germination runs into wound and also can infect, and need not to grow to form appresorium.Therefore, usually use tricyclazole control rice blast separately because service time partially evening or behind the storm that easily makes paddy rice generation wound result of use not good.Also there is the problem that activity is low, the later stage is used easy poisoning in sulfur preparation commonly used.Therefore, according to the rice blast pests occurrence rule with prevent and treat situation, development is efficient, the new type bactericide of wide spectrum, low toxicity, safety meets the Rice Production demand.
Three, summary of the invention
Technical problem the object of the invention is to research and develop disinfecting agent prescription and the using method thereof of control rice blast, the technical problem underlying of its solution be control rice blast effect significantly, medication period and application method is various, and can delay development of drug resistance, the good bacteriocide formula of active ingredient compatibility and easy using method are provided.
Selection of technical scheme is high to the Pyricularia oryzae activity, the longevity of residure is long, mechanism of action is different, can bring into play activity in the disease cycle different phase, different low toxicity, low-residual bactericide tricyclazole, Tebuconazole and the Difenoconazole of interior suction conductive performance be filled a prescription and be screened and field trial, obtain the prescription of performance summation action or synergistic effect, and be processed into the preparation of different user demands.
Beneficial effect the present invention is directed to existing production and goes up the tricyclazole that uses and can only prevent and treat rice blast and can not prevent and treat other diseases, have only splendid protective effect and do not have therapeutic action; triazole bactericidal agent has wide spectrum, high activity and splendid therapeutic action and anti-sporification; and Tebuconazole is inhaled in conduction and the Difenoconazole in having fast and is absorbed and retain the characteristics of staying; fill a prescription and screen and field trial, obtain tricyclazole: Tebuconazole: the weight ratio of Difenoconazole is 1: 0.04~0.8: 0.04~0.8 the useful prescription of composite bactericide.Carry out indoor and field trial and prove that this invention compares with other agricultural chemicals and have following beneficial effect by making different preparations.
1. the invention belongs to the prescription of ternary built bactericide, have compatibility, enlarged antimicrobial spectrum, to Different Kinds of Pathogens fungi performance summation action and synergistic effect, not only can prevent and treat rice blast, can also doublely control banded sclerotial blight, false smut and leaf smut, reduce labour and agricultural chemicals use cost.
2. this prescription has trihydroxy naphthols reductase, tetrahydroxy naphthols reductase and 14 α-demethylase to the molecular target of Pyricularia oryzae effect, has increased action site, can delay the pesticide resistance generation and prevent and treat the pesticide resistance disease.
3. tricyclazole has splendid protective effect in this prescription; Tebuconazole and Difenoconazole have splendid therapeutic action and anti-sporification; each stage in disease cycle all can bring into play active; make the service time of this bactericide looser, overcome the difficult problem missing best administration time in the past and can lose control efficiency.
4. three of this invention kinds of bacteriocide formulas have the characteristic that is absorbed by paddy rice fast, can resist rain drop erosion and photodissociation, and the longevity of residure is long.
5. tricyclazole and Tebuconazole conductive performance in the paddy rice body are good in the bactericide that should invent, with transpiration to paddy rice top and blade tip transporting, and the poor mobility of Difenoconazole can be trapped in paddy rice middle and lower part and dispenser position, has good distributivity in the paddy rice body.Therefore can use by methods such as soaking seed, spray and spread fertilizer over the fields, the effect of preventing and treating disease significantly improves.
6. the inventor studies have shown that the triazole bactericidal agent Tebuconazole has good plant physiology regulating action, makes that plant is resistant to lodging, chlorophyll increase, peroxidation decline, ripening rate and thousand kernel weight increases, and improves output.

(4) effect test conclusion
Indoor and field trial proof tricyclazole, Tebuconazole and three kinds of bactericide active ingredients of Difenoconazole have compatibility.Under the situation of total amount greater than the total amount of other two kinds of triazole bactericidal agents of tricyclazole, the different proportion mixing post processing rice seedling of ternary built agent is compared the synergistic effect that all has in various degree to postvaccinal rice blast occurrence degree control effect with using single agent.With tricyclazole: Tebuconazole: the proportioning of Difenoconazole 1: 0.04~0.8: 1: 0.04~0.8 is handled rice shoot, and synergistic effect is the most obvious.Select 40% and 44% wetting powder and 5% and 10% water dispersible granules and the granules of wherein 6 kinds of different proportionings processing, by water is sprayed, seed treatment and distinct methods such as spread fertilizer over the fields, the effect of control seedling pest and panicle blast is all very good.Particularly use obvious effect of increasing production in the later stage.
